What is a PhD in machine learning?

A PhD in Machine Learning is an advanced doctoral degree focused on developing new algorithms, theories, and applications in the field of machine learning. Graduates typically conduct original research, contribute to academic publications, and often specialize in areas like deep learning, reinforcement learning, or probabilistic modeling. This degree prepares individuals for careers in academia, industry research labs, or leadership roles in tech companies. The program usually involves coursework, comprehensive exams, and the completion of a dissertation based on novel research.

What are some common challenges faced by PhD-level professionals in machine learning when transitioning from academia to industry roles?

PhD graduates in machine learning often encounter challenges such as adapting to faster-paced project timelines, aligning research with business objectives, and collaborating in multidisciplinary teams. Unlike academia, where projects can be exploratory and long-term, industry roles usually require actionable results within shorter deadlines. Additionally, communicating complex technical ideas to non-technical stakeholders and prioritizing practical solutions over theoretical novelty are key adjustments. However, these challenges also present opportunities for professional growth and broader impact.

What can you do with a PhD in machine learning?

A PhD in machine learning prepares individuals for advanced roles such as research scientist, machine learning engineer, data scientist, or AI specialist. These roles involve developing algorithms, analyzing large datasets, and applying AI techniques across industries like technology, healthcare, finance, and autonomous systems. Strong programming skills and knowledge of tools like Python, TensorFlow, or PyTorch are essential for these positions.
